Whenever the vehicle battery is disconnected or discharged, or related fuse is blown, you must reset your sunroof system as follows:
1. Turn the ignition switch to the ON position and close the sunroof completely.
2. Release the control lever.
3. Push and hold the control lever forward (for more than 10 seconds) until the
sunroof tilts and slightly moves. Then, release the lever.
4. Within 3 seconds, push and hold the control lever forward (for more than 5 seconds)
until the sunroof is operated as follows;
TILT DOWN → SLIDE OPEN → SLIDE CLOSE
Then, release the control lever.
When this is complete, the sunroof system is reset.

CAUTION
If the sunroof is not reset when the vehicle battery is disconnected or discharged, or related fuse is blown, the sunroof may operate improperly.
